Transaction 10066ffe326213976c8718fd7186959f73689b9ec52d918bdb3076c2c9364393

1 Input
2 Outputs
  • 10066ffe326213976c8718fd7186959f73689b9ec52d918bdb3076c2c9364393:0
  • value  70554
    address  1P5YSAciRhwDSSnDNbMZaegBXzAfLvLQpa
  • 10066ffe326213976c8718fd7186959f73689b9ec52d918bdb3076c2c9364393:1
  • value  11283330
    address  19qky3Co736j2o5c7hWUBBGkijDYSQ87XJ